Address 0 IDC

ibs1LoSk4xW5jxRD7faMbtgdPFnCGHnECJ

Confirmed

Total Received47165924.828313 IDC
Total Sent47165924.828313 IDC
Final Balance0 IDC
No. Transactions2

Transactions

ibs1LoSk4xW5jxRD7faMbtgdPFnCGHnECJ47165924.828313 IDC
Fee: 0.000022 IDC
383808 Confirmations47165924.828291 IDC
ibs1LoSk4xW5jxRD7faMbtgdPFnCGHnECJ47165924.828313 IDC
iTEuDmyKdTHeJLyuFLiYcnB7d4sMp5VuYw100 IDC ×
Fee: 0.000022 IDC
383809 Confirmations47166024.828313 IDC